ALSA: hda/proc - Add const to possible places
authorTakashi Iwai <tiwai@suse.de>
Mon, 17 Aug 2015 12:52:51 +0000 (14:52 +0200)
committerTakashi Iwai <tiwai@suse.de>
Mon, 17 Aug 2015 13:11:31 +0000 (15:11 +0200)
Many arrays in hda_proc.c are string arrays that should be covered by
const prefix for increasing the safety and reducing the size.

Signed-off-by: Takashi Iwai <tiwai@suse.de>
